When teams in volunteer organisations aren’t succeeding, it’s because their leaders are failing to do these five things:1 - Set and Achieve Goals2 - Solve Problems and Make Decisions3 - Prioritise and Stay Focused4 - Believe and Inspire Others to Believe5 - Perform and Get ResultsAs the team leader, everything is within your zone of influence. The buck starts and stops with you.

In this episode, I am going to be sharing with you my reflective lesson on leadership. This reflective lesson is the application of military principles in a volunteer organisation. The military principle is that there are no bad teams, only bad leaders.
